Last night, several of the world's most celebrated musicians joined forces at the Key Club in Hollywood, Calif. for the third installment of the Metal Masters series.

The concert/clinic featured Kerry King and Dave Lombardo (Slayer), David Ellefson (Megadeth), Charlie Benante and Frank Bello (Anthrax) and Mike Portnoy (Adrenaline Mob/Flying Colors), all performing at various points throughout the night

If that lineup wasn't already killer enough, Phil Anselmo (Down, ex-Pantera) and Geezer Butler (Black Sabbath, ex-Heaven and Hell) both made surprise appearances, leaving all in attendance with their mouths agape.

Anselmo treated the packed club to ripping versions of Slayer's "Raining Blood" and "Angel of Death," before breaking into "A New Level," "Mouth for War," "This Love" and "Walk." Butler then got on stage and joined the all-star band through Black Sabbath's "Hole in the Sky."
